When encountering such posts, especially those that imply free access to files, it's essential to exercise caution. Here are a few considerations:
Security: Be aware that accessing files from unknown sources can pose security risks to your device and personal data. There's a potential for malware or other harmful content.
Legality: The legality of sharing or accessing files can vary greatly depending on the content, the laws of your country, and the terms of service of the website being used.
Website Legitimacy: The legitimacy of "Filesrightnow.com" is not verified in this context. Some websites may use such methods to attract users but could have ulterior motives.
Password Protection: If a file is password-protected, ensure you trust the source before attempting to access it.

The Truth About FilesRightNow.com and "Free" Passwords
Most files labeled with specific codes like Hj9 on third-party hosting sites are part of a common scam cycle:
Survey Locks: You are often asked to complete a survey or "human verification" to see the password, but the password is rarely provided.
Malware Risks: These downloads can contain Trojans, ransomware, or adware designed to compromise your computer.
Phishing: Sites may ask for your email or phone number to "unlock" the file, leading to spam or identity theft. How to Stay Safe
